### Step 4: Archive cold storage buckets

Before merging, confirm the Vaultmere archiver has been pointed at each cold bucket listed in the migration manifest. The archiver compresses objects older than 180 days into sealed segments and writes tombstones in place; reads after archiving go through the restore proxy, so expect first-access latency of a few seconds. Do not delete source buckets until checksums are verified in step 5. Run the archiver for this step with the configuration shown below.

settings of tagef-bawif:
DRUIX_HOST=druix.zemvarlabs.internal
DRUIX_PORT=8000

TICKET-4182: Intermittent connection failures on Larkspur API

We're seeing "too many open files" errors roughly every six hours on the Larkspur ingest workers. Current theory: a leaked file descriptor somewhere in the retry wrapper around the payments client. New folks, this is a good ticket to shadow — the debugging loop is: reproduce under load, snapshot lsof output, diff against baseline. The leak only shows when the pool talks to the primary. To reproduce locally, point your worker at the staging database with the connection string below.

warehouse DSN: mssql://rusdor_svc:0FSWCn9@db-951a.paliqforge.local:5432/ulawyn

Plugin authors: assignment is now computed from a salted hash of the subject key, so custom hooks must not mutate the key after enrollment. The `preAssign` callback gains a read-only context; `postAssign` is unchanged. Sticky assignments persist across config pushes unless the experiment epoch increments. Backwards compatible except for plugins that relied on random reassignment per session — those must migrate. Default hash salt rotation and bucket counts are defined by the constants below.

constants for tafog-kahag:
RATE_LIMITS = {
    "sorir": 697,
    "oliox": 683,
    "holax": 176,
    "casox": 60,
    "pelius": 382,
}